President Kennedy, visit to Hanau, Germany
John F. Kennedy, the nation's 35th President, would have turned 100 years old on May 29, 2017. With the centennial anniversary of John F. Kennedy's birth, the former president's legacy is being celebrated across the nation. PICTURED: June 25, 1963 - Hanau, Germany - President JOHN F. KENNEDY troops the line of 15000 soldiers in his car during a troop inspection held at Fliegerhorst Kaserne in Hanau, Germany. This was the biggest troop demonstration held in Europe by the US Forces
